Macrobathra arneutis Meyrick 1914

Abstract

Macrobathra arneutis Meyrick, 1914 (Figs 4, 21, 35) Macrobathra arneutis Meyrick, 1914: 218. TL: India (Assam). TD: NHMUK. Material examined. CHINA, Fujian: 3♀, 8–9.VIII.2020; Guangxi: 7♁ 4♀, 1.VII.2009 – 9.VIII.2022; Guizhou: 3♁ 1♀, 17.VIII.2004 – 16.VII.2019; Hainan: 28♁ 7♀, 7.V.2010 – 27.V.2015; Hunan: 2♁ 2♀, 26.VII.2020; Jiangxi: 3♁ 2♀, 2–7.VII.1978; Yunnan: 12♁ 1♀, 16.V.2014 – 8.VI.2015; Xizang: 38♁ 32♀, 12.VIII.2003 – 5.VIII.2018; Zhejiang: 11♁ 6♀, 15.VIII.1999 – 1.VIII.2011. Diagnosis. Adult (Fig. 4). Wingspan 10.5–12.0 mm. Macrobathra arneutis is diagnosed by the forewing with the outer margin of the subbasal fascia distinctly oblique outward in anterior half; in the male genitalia by the symmetrical socius and valva (Fig. 21); and in the female genitalia by the ductus bursae sclerotized and slightly widened posteriorly, and the globular corpus bursae (Fig. 35). It is similar to M. trigonilamella sp. nov., and the differences between them are stated in the diagnosis of the new species. Distribution. China (Fujian, Guangxi, Guizhou, Hainan, Hunan, Jiangxi, Xizang, Yunnan, Zhejiang), India.

Published as part of Zhang, Di & Li, Houhun, 2023, Review of the genus Macrobathra Meyrick, 1883 (Lepidoptera: Cosmopterigidae) in China, pp. 227-246 in Zootaxa 5330 (2) on page 233, DOI: 10.11646/zootaxa.5330.2.3, http://zenodo.org/record/8249282
